세계 의료 정보 교환(HIE) 시장 규모는 2024년 17억 달러에서 2029년까지 28억 달러에 달할 것으로 예상되며, 2024-2029년 연평균 10.2%의 CAGR을 기록할 것으로 전망됩니다.

의료 생태계 전반에서 환자의 의료 정보를 원활하고 안전하게 교환할 수 있게 됨에 따라 시장 성장이 촉진되고 있습니다. 의료 서비스의 단편화가 심화되고 환자가 다양한 환경에서 여러 의료 서비스 제공자로부터 진료를 받음에 따라 진료의 연계와 연속성을 보장해야 할 필요성이 증가하고 있습니다. 또한, 상호운용성과 데이터 교환을 촉진하기 위한 규제적 의무와 정부 이니셔티브가 HIE 솔루션 도입에 박차를 가하고 있으며, Medicare Access and CHIP Reauthorization Act(MACRA), Promoting Interoperability Program(구 Meaningful Use)과 같은 프로그램은 의료기관이 HIE 기능을 갖춘 인증된 전자건강기록(EHR) 시스템을 채택하도록 장려하고 있습니다. 그러나 표준화된 데이터 포맷의 부재, 호환되지 않는 시스템, 관할권별로 상이한 규제 요건 등은 시장에서 큰 도전이 되고 있습니다.

"의료 정보 교환(HIE), 포털 중심의 HIE 솔루션 부문이 예측 기간 동안 가장 높은 성장세를 보일 것"

2023년 포털 중심 솔루션 부문이 가장 큰 시장 점유율을 차지했습니다. 포털 중심 솔루션은 예측 기간 동안 가장 높은 성장세를 보일 것으로 예상됩니다. 이 부문의 성장에 기여하는 주요 요인 중 하나는 사용자 친화적인 접근 방식과 환자의 의료 정보에 대한 원활한 접근을 용이하게 하는 능력입니다. 예를 들어, 전자 의료 기록(EHR) 선도 업체인 Epic Systems Corporation은 2023년 9월에 새로운 MyChart Bedside 포털을 발표했습니다. 이 포털을 통해 환자는 병원 침대 옆에서 직접 자신의 건강 기록에 액세스하고 의료진과 소통할 수 있습니다. 이 혁신적인 포털 중심 솔루션은 환자가 의료에 더 적극적으로 참여할 수 있도록 할 뿐만 아니라 환자와 의료 서비스 제공자 간의 커뮤니케이션과 정보 공유를 간소화하여 궁극적으로 치료 조정과 환자 만족도를 향상시킬 수 있습니다. 또한, HIE 시장의 포털 중심 부문은 특히 COVID-19 팬데믹에 대응하기 위해 원격의료 및 원격 환자 모니터링 기술의 채택이 증가함에 따라 큰 성장세를 보이고 있습니다. 의료기관은 포털 중심 HIE 솔루션을 활용하여 가상 방문을 촉진하고, 진단 검사 결과를 공유하며, 환자의 경과를 원격으로 모니터링하고 있습니다.

"웹 포털 개발 부문이 시장에서 가장 큰 시장 점유율을 차지했습니다."

웹 포털 개발 부문은 2023년 가장 큰 시장 점유율을 차지했는데, 이는 의료 제공자와 환자 모두 환자의 의료 정보에 대한 원활한 접근을 용이하게 하는 데 중요한 역할을 하기 때문입니다. 관련 임상 데이터를 안전하게 열람, 교환 및 관리할 수 있는 중앙 집중식 플랫폼 역할을 합니다. 웹 포털 개발 부문이 우위를 점하는 주요 이유 중 하나는 모든 규모와 전문 분야를 가진 의료 기관에서 널리 채택되고 있기 때문입니다. 의료 서비스 제공자들은 웹 포털을 통해 전자 의료 기록(EHR) 시스템, 검사 데이터베이스, 영상 저장소 등 여러 출처의 환자 정보에 액세스하고 워크플로우를 간소화하며 진료 협업을 강화하기 위해 웹 포털을 활용하고 있습니다.

The global Health Information Exchange market is projected to reach USD 2.8 billion by 2029 from USD 1.7 billion in 2024, at a CAGR of 10.2% from 2024 to 2029. The growth of the market is fuelled due to seamless and secure exchange of patient health information across the healthcare ecosystem. As healthcare delivery becomes increasingly fragmented, with patients receiving care from multiple providers and across various settings, there is a growing need to ensure care coordination and continuity. Moreover, regulatory mandates and government initiatives aimed at promoting interoperability and data exchange have fueled the adoption of HIE solutions. Programs such as the Medicare Access and CHIP Reauthorization Act (MACRA) and the Promoting Interoperability Program (formerly known as Meaningful Use) incentivize healthcare organizations to adopt certified electronic health record (EHR) systems with HIE capabilities. However lack of standardized data formats, incompatible systems, and varying regulatory requirements across different jurisdictions poses a significant challenge within this market.

"Health Information Exchange, portal-centric HIE solution segment to witness the highest growth during the forecast period."

Based on solution, the Health Information Exchange market is segmented into portal-centric solutions, messaging-centric solutions, and platform-centric solutions. The portal-centric solution segment held the largest market share in 2023. The portal-centric solutions segment to witness the highest growth during forecast period. One major factor contributing to the growth of this segment is due to its user-friendly approach and ability to facilitate seamless access to patient health information. For instance, in September 2023, Epic Systems Corporation, a leading electronic health record (EHR) vendor, unveiled its new MyChart Bedside portal, which enables patients to access their health records and communicate with care teams directly from their hospital bedside. This innovative portal-centric solution not only empowers patients to take a more active role in their healthcare but also streamlines communication and information sharing between patients and providers, ultimately improving care coordination and patient satisfaction. Furthermore, the portal-centric segment of the HIE market has witnessed significant growth due to the increasing adoption of telehealth and remote patient monitoring technologies, particularly in response to the COVID-19 pandemic. Healthcare organizations have leveraged portal-centric HIE solutions to facilitate virtual visits, share diagnostic test results, and monitor patient progress remotely.

"Web portal development segment held the largest market share in the Health Information Exchange Market ."

Based on application, the Health Information Exchange market is segmented into web-portal development, workflow management, secure messaging, internal interfacing, and other application. Web portal development segment held the largest market share in 2023 due to its crucial role in facilitating seamless access to patient health information for both healthcare providers and patients. Web portals serve as centralized platforms where users can securely view, exchange, and manage their health records, diagnostic reports, medication histories, and other relevant clinical data. One key reason for the dominance of the web portal development segment is its widespread adoption across healthcare organizations of all sizes and specialties. Providers rely on web portals to access patient information from multiple sources, including electronic health record (EHR) systems, laboratory databases, and imaging repositories, thereby streamlining workflows and enhancing care coordination.

"Healthcare Provider segment to register the highest growth in the Health Information Exchange market during the forecast period."

Based on end user, the Health Information Exchange solution market is segmented into healthcare provider, healthcare payers, and pharmacies. In 2023, the healthcare provider segment held the largest share among the end user due to their pivotal role in care delivery and management of patient health data. Recent instances highlight the increasing focus of US healthcare providers on the adoption of HIE solutions to enhance care coordination, improve patient outcomes, and comply with regulatory requirements. For example, in June 2023, Mayo Clinic, a renowned healthcare provider, announced its partnership with Microsoft to deploy the Azure Health Data Services platform, leveraging HIE capabilities to streamline data sharing across its network of hospitals and clinics. This initiative highlights the growing recognition among healthcare providers of the value of HIE in facilitating seamless information exchange and interoperability between disparate systems.

"APAC is estimated to register the highest CAGR during the forecast period."

In this report, the Health Information Exchange market is segmented segments, namely, North America, Europe, Asia Pacific, Latin America and Middle East and Africa. The Health Information Exchange market in APAC is projected to register the highest CAGR rate during the forecast period. The growth of this region is due to rapidly evolving healthcare landscape in APAC, characterized by increasing digitization, urbanization, and healthcare expenditure. As healthcare systems modernize and expand to meet the needs of growing populations, there is a growing recognition of the importance of interoperability and data exchange in improving care coordination, enhancing patient outcomes, and driving healthcare efficiency. Moreover, government initiatives and regulatory reforms aimed at promoting healthcare IT adoption and interoperability are driving the growth of the HIE market in APAC. Countries such as China, Japan, South Korea, and Australia have launched national health IT initiatives and interoperability frameworks to facilitate the exchange of electronic health records (EHRs) and health information among healthcare providers. For instance, China's Healthy China 2030 initiative and Australia's My Health Record program are driving investments in HIE infrastructure and technology to support integrated care delivery and population health management.
